CLEVELAND, Ohio (AP) A civil jury has found a woman liable for malicious prosecution in a rape allegation she made against a former Ohio State football standout more than five years ago, Cleveland.com reported. The accusation against Gareon Conley came shortly before the 2017 NFL draft, in which he had been projected to be a high first-round pick. Conley's attorney said the sex was consensual.
